Tuipui Population - Champhai, Mizoram
Tuipui is a medium size village located in Khawzawl Block of Champhai district, Mizoram with total 95 families residing. The Tuipui village has population of 461 of which 217 are males while 244 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Tuipui village population of children with age 0-6 is 75 which makes up 16.27 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Tuipui village is 1124 which is higher than Mizoram state average of 976. Child Sex Ratio for the Tuipui as per census is 1419, higher than Mizoram average of 970.
Tuipui village has higher literacy rate compared to Mizoram. In 2011, literacy rate of Tuipui village was 100.00 % compared to 91.33 % of Mizoram. In Tuipui Male literacy stands at 100.00 % while female literacy rate was 100.00 %.

Tuipui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 95 | - | - |
Population | 461 | 217 | 244 |
Child (0-6) | 75 | 31 | 44 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 443 | 210 | 233 |
Literacy | 100.00 % | 100.00 % | 100.00 % |
Total Workers | 229 | 132 | 97 |
Main Worker | 225 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 4 | 1 | 3 |
